账号密码登录
微信安全登录
微信扫描二维码登录

登录后绑定QQ、微信即可实现信息互通

手机验证码登录
找回密码返回
邮箱找回 手机找回
注册账号返回
其他登录方式
分享
  • 收藏
    X
    请教一下关于ERP的数据库设计
    29
    0

    公司最近需要做一个ERP,由于没什么经验,所以设计表这块不太清楚目前设计这样的方案是否正确
    目前我设计的是,物料表有物料的详细信息,大概有30-40左右的物料信息字段。
    但是我在做采购单和销售单的时候,就有把物料的信息一起写到数据库的采购详情表和销售详情表里,
    但是我做出入库和收发货这些,我就只是关联了物料的主键进出入库和收发货的详情表里面,没有把所所有字段都写进去,
    就读出来的时候,是用主键去管理信息,显示出来
    我想问下,这样的设计是否合理?传统的是否是这样的设计方式?
    在出入库和收发货这些明细表中,是否需要把这些物料的信息都写进去?还是只是关联主键就可以了?
    求高手指导一下,谢谢

    0
    打赏
    收藏
    点击回答
        全部回答
    • 0
    • ミ长发小鹿纯▽\ 普通会员 1楼

      ERP(企业资源规划)的数据库设计是一个复杂的过程,需要根据企业的具体需求和业务流程来设计。一般来说,ERP数据库的设计主要包括以下几个方面:

      1. 表的设计:表是用来存储数据的基本元素,表的结构和字段数量会根据企业的业务流程和数据需求来确定。在ERP中,通常会涉及到大量的表,例如采购表、销售表、库存表、财务表等。

      2. 数据库结构:数据库结构包括表的结构、字段的类型、数据的约束等。数据库结构的设计需要考虑到数据的准确性、完整性、一致性等因素。

      3. 数据类型:ERP中使用的数据类型主要有文本、数字、日期、时间、布尔值、二进制等。这些数据类型的选择会直接影响到数据的存储和查询效率。

      4. 索引:在ERP中,数据库中会使用索引来提高查询效率。索引通常是在表中创建的特殊表格,它可以帮助数据库快速地查找满足条件的记录。

      5. 安全性:ERP中需要考虑到数据的安全性,例如防止数据泄露、防止数据被篡改等。在设计数据库时,需要考虑到这些因素,并采取相应的措施来保护数据的安全。

      6. 数据备份:ERP中需要定期备份数据库,以防数据丢失。在设计数据库时,需要考虑到备份的时间和频率,并采取相应的措施来保证数据的安全。

      以上就是ERP数据库设计的一些基本方面,具体的细节还需要根据企业的实际需求来确定。

    更多回答
    扫一扫访问手机版
    • 回到顶部
    • 回到顶部